Te Rito Maioha Early Childhood New Zealand Incorporated is a Trust charity in the Education sector, based in Wellington, Wellington. CharityData rates this charity D+ (51.5/100). Annual revenue: $19.7M NZD. Financial data as at December 2024.
Mission: Te Rito Maioha is a bicultural organisation committed to advocacy, teaching, promotion and delivery of world class early childhood education for children, whānau, teachers and ECE services. We respond by being agile, connected and contributing to ensure successful learning happens together. For over 60 years we have been advocating for higher standards in Early Childhood Education.
